Ordinals
beta
Address 3PZz9cXWu1BK7xL1iNrCDTYwRHuveAjGp1
sat balance
11981775
outputs
16a99f1a953230d8b5d4c3e055050eae5a80cefc3dd29bb70ce76c9ffb9dfbc7:0